Textpattern CMS support forum
You are not logged in. Register | Login | Help
- Topics: Active | Unanswered
#1 2009-06-26 20:51:07
- gfdesign
- Member
- From: Argentina
- Registered: 2009-04-20
- Posts: 401
[es-es] <txp:older> y <txp:newer> antes del listado de articulos
Amigos, vuelvo con otra consulta.
¿Es posible colocar etiquetas <txp:older> y <txp:newer> antes de un listado de articulos ?
Saludos y gracias
Offline
Re: [es-es] <txp:older> y <txp:newer> antes del listado de articulos
Probaste y no funcionó? En ese caso… creo que es posible, pero para eso hay que hacer un truquito, si mal no recuerdo.
Tenés que poner un <txp:article pgonly="1" />
antes (más arriba) de txp:older
y txp:newer
.
Asegurate además, que ese <txp:article pgonly="1" />
tenga exactamente los mismos atributos que el otro <txp:article />
que tenés en la plantilla (es decir, el “verdadero”, el que efectivamente “escupe” los artículos).
El atributo pgonly
sirve para “paginar solamente”, es decir, hace la llamada a la base de datos para “calcular” cuántos artículos va a tener que traer, y blablabla, y en consecuencia, vi va a necesitar usar o no el txp:older
y el txp:newer
.
Offline
#3 2009-06-29 03:24:59
- gfdesign
- Member
- From: Argentina
- Registered: 2009-04-20
- Posts: 401
Re: [es-es] <txp:older> y <txp:newer> antes del listado de articulos
Me funciona pero a medias ya que al navegar en la paginación, desparece la etiqueta <txp:older>. (He leido en varios foros que es un error común que esta etiqueta desaparezca).
Lo solucioné mediante CSS, colocando en el codigo <txp:older> y <txp:newer> despues de la llamada a la lista de articulos, pero ubicándolo visualmente antes a través de estilos.
Gracias de todos modos.
Offline
#4 2009-10-09 14:55:59
- Fede
- Member
- From: BA
- Registered: 2009-09-28
- Posts: 10
Re: [es-es] <txp:older> y <txp:newer> antes del listado de articulos
muy útil el truquito del pgonly, solucionó mi problema, gracias!
aunque todavía no entiendo por qué fue necesario, si la navegación está al final… ¿me pueden explicar?
<!-- center --> <div id="content"> <txp:if_category> <h2><txp:category title="1" /></h2> <div class="hfeed"> <txp:article form="article_listing" limit="5" /> </div> <txp:else /> <div id="migajas"><ul><li><txp:section title="1" link="1" class="miga" /></li> </ul></div> <div class="hfeed"> <txp:article form="<txp:if_section name="socios">archivos<txp:else/>agenda</txp:if_section>" limit="5" /> </div> </txp:if_category> <txp:if_individual_article> <p align="center"><txp:link_to_prev showalways="1">« Anterior</txp:link_to_prev> <txp:section link="1">Volver</txp:section> <txp:link_to_next showalways="1">Siguiente »</txp:link_to_next></p> <txp:else /> <p align="center"> <txp:article pgonly="1" /> <txp:newer>« Anteriores</txp:newer> <txp:older>Siguientes »</txp:older> </p> </txp:if_individual_article> </div> <!-- footer -->
gracias!
Last edited by Fede (2009-10-09 15:15:25)
Offline